How to fill out financial disclosure - oec

How to fill out financial disclosure - oec
01
To fill out a financial disclosure form, follow these steps:
02
Obtain the financial disclosure form from the appropriate source, such as your employer or a government agency.
03
Read the instructions on the form carefully to understand what information is required and how to fill it out.
04
Gather all relevant financial documents, such as bank statements, tax returns, investment statements, and property records.
05
Start by providing your personal information, such as your name, address, and contact details.
06
List all sources of income, including salaries, wages, rental income, dividends, and any other financial gains.
07
Declare all assets you own, such as real estate, vehicles, investments, and valuable possessions.
08
Provide details about any debts or liabilities you have, including mortgages, loans, credit card balances, and outstanding bills.
09
Include information about any financial interests or affiliations you have, such as ownership in companies or partnerships.
10
Disclose any financial gifts or contributions you have received or made during the reporting period.
11
Double-check all entries for accuracy and completeness.
12
Sign and date the form, acknowledging that the information provided is true and accurate to the best of your knowledge.
13
Submit the completed financial disclosure form to the appropriate recipient within the specified deadline.
14
Note: It is important to consult any specific guidelines or requirements related to financial disclosure in your jurisdiction or organization.
Who needs financial disclosure - oec?
01
Financial disclosure is typically required for individuals holding public or sensitive positions, such as government officials, politicians, high-ranking executives, board members, and others responsible for making decisions that may have a financial impact.
02
In the context of the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development (OECD), financial disclosure is often required for public officials, politicians, and senior executives in member countries to promote transparency, prevent conflicts of interest, and deter corruption.
03
Specific requirements for financial disclosure may vary depending on the jurisdiction, organization, or sector in which the individual operates. It is important to consult applicable laws, regulations, or policies to determine who needs to submit a financial disclosure.

What is financial disclosure - oec?
Financial disclosure - oec is a process or requirement for individuals to disclose their financial information, including assets, income, liabilities, and investments, to promote transparency and prevent conflicts of interest.
Who is required to file financial disclosure - oec?
Officials, employees, and certain individuals holding key positions in organizations are required to file financial disclosure - oec.
How to fill out financial disclosure - oec?
Financial disclosure - oec forms are typically provided by the organization or governing body requiring the disclosure. The individual must complete the form accurately, providing all necessary financial information.
What is the purpose of financial disclosure - oec?
The purpose of financial disclosure - oec is to ensure transparency, prevent conflicts of interest, and maintain public trust by revealing potential financial influences on decision-making.
What information must be reported on financial disclosure - oec?
Financial disclosure - oec typically requires reporting of assets, income sources, liabilities, investments, gifts, and other financial interests.
